Output 108a86a6f2a861b23120c3c6fc39a416de1df5185bb40b51feb89152f537a2b4:21

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bf5b81f05421e9a04df78d414dca352395271b8 OP_EQUALVERIFY OP_CHECKSIG
address
16U3EBxbQ1GxizZL3tULpLQtNbnUQFwGUF
transaction
108a86a6f2a861b23120c3c6fc39a416de1df5185bb40b51feb89152f537a2b4
spent
true